Output e4afdee265e483d61a8c8c67e6cb48aff7b288b2c54fca76cec36fd1ff386ca7:0

value
17981627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 447c717624d3eada5e5fba8d4fcd56153e9fe107 OP_EQUAL
address
37w8x45nuZkAu7xurHyeDiqhmvHYHnjnJQ
transaction
e4afdee265e483d61a8c8c67e6cb48aff7b288b2c54fca76cec36fd1ff386ca7
confirmations
169830
spent
true